What exactly do I need to do to tune the ejector? I am tuning the extractor but have not tested again. Was thinking about the AFTEC, heard they are good but a pain to get in and out.

Top 1/3 way down in front slight angle and bottom 2/3 opposite angle making a bit of a point where the two meet. The aftec isn't hard to remove just be careful you don't loose the spring and spring holder when you push it out

Bought and installed the Aftec in my STI DVC, had to modify the back stop a little to get it to fit the Aftec. Have not tested it at the range yet, but it does hold the brass better than the original extractor. If this does not take care of the problem, I will get the ejector.

My Steelmaster had all sorts of extraction/ ejection problems due to very weak extractor tension (9ozs), out of the box. I retensioned the extractor to 28 oz and it cured the problem for a short time. I rechecked the tension on the extractor and it fell to 18 oz. I replaced the STI extractor with an Aftec extractor and its been running like a scalded dog ever since. Im Running 115 gr Montana Gold HP at 1060 fps. I also replaced the recoil master with a full length guide rod and 7lb recoil spring.
